At any given time, one can find the certified skin specialists at Ador Skin Care & Spa polishing complexions with anti-aging facials, swiping away unwanted fuzz with waxing treatments, or dipping hands and feet into paraffin wax during European mani-pedis. Though their diverse talents have led to a lengthy menu of spa services, the specialists rely chiefly on one line of products—Sothys— which channels more than 60 years of research into formulations that make skin glow brighter than a jellyfish rave.
B-True Organics's formidable skincare boutique has a lot in common with the produce section of a grocery store. Products are crafted with botanicals such as fennel, grapefruit, or mango, and they're almost pure enough to eat. That's because every pH-balanced shampoo, body lotion, and eye shadow contains no harsh chemicals and is never tested on animals or particularly hairy coconuts. In addition to their in-house line of products, B-True Organics carries brands such as Dr. Bronner's, ilike, and Spa Ritual. B-True's respectable menu of spa services lets customers put its products to the test in private treatment rooms as they receive organic facials or massages that draw from Hawaiian and Balinese techniques.
Transform Age Management helps clients stuck in the middle of their aesthetic journey, providing cosmetic solutions that transcend the results possible with traditional skincare regimes, but stop short of surgery. Executive director and founder Sasha Parker draws upon 25 years of experience spent working as a nurse, assistant surgical administrator, and medical aesthetic trainer to helm a team of doctors and registered nurses who help clients look and feel their best. The collection of beauty services ranges from hydrafacials, peels, and age-fighting dermal fillers to laser therapies that can remove unwanted hair, tighten facial skin, or etch important dates into the brain. If one’s compass does point to the surgical route, clients can find direction from board-certified plastic surgeon Dr. F. Leigh Phillips, who performs everything from abdominoplasty to full and partial face-lifts.
Dr. Yelena Pakula practiced as a medical doctor in Russia before changing fields and continents more than a decade ago. Now an acupuncturist licensed by the state of Florida, she runs Vita-Health Acupuncture and Wellness Center, a clinic for nonconventional healing and aesthetic medicine. She and her colleagues—including another expatriate physician from Brazil—perform acupuncture and herbal treatments, along with massage therapy and colon hydrotherapy. Their beauty menu includes treatments to laser away body hair, contour the thighs and stomach, and rejuvenate complexions after one too many ghost sightings.
Royal Treatment Skin Care & Beauty’s owner, Samantha Kerr, doesn't need curtains or wall partitions to ensure her guests’ privacy. Her one client at a time philosophy calls for each guest to receive the dedicated attention of an aesthetician undistracted by other customers tapping their feet in the lobby or clambering through the air ducts.
This allows Kerr and her team to do what they do best: cleanse, exfoliate, and extract toxins from the skin. The spa’s menu of services includes facials and peels that target specific skin conditions as well as body-smoothing, makeup, eyelash extensions, and waxing treatments. When she's not engaged in one-on-one consultations with her clients, Kerr keeps busy by hosting interactive training workshops in various beauty treatments.
